73rd Independence Day

The students of classes 6 – 8, hosted the 73rd Independence Day celebrations on                15th August 2019, St. Britto’s Academy, Chennai.

The Programme started off, with the Indian Flag being hoisted by the Chief Guest Mr. K. Gowthaman – DSP, special investigation division, CB-CID. March past was headed by the Head boy and the head girl, followed by the Scouts and Guides and four house captains who led their teams to pay reverence and respect to the Flag and the Chief Guest. Vandematram song and the drill formation culminating in the Indian Tricolor Flag Formation enthralled the audience. Prayer song was rendered by the choir followed by the prayer for nation which set the stage for special song- “Achamillai” and various patriotic programs like the group dance, speech in Hindi, skit exhibiting the bravery of the freedom fighter – Maruthanayagam, the dialogue – which projected some eminent Indian personalities, their lifetime achievements etc.

The main focus of the day was a virtual visualization for a progressing nation like India – towards 2050, through a Talk show and Tableau. This event was certainly a torchbearer to highlight the tremendous development.

The Chief Guest’s message highlighted that Education plays a vital part in everyone’s life and such a higher order of learning must be internalized and nurtured within each one of us, so as to become compassionate human beings and make this Earth a better place to live in. He also felicitated the Cubs and Bulbuls for their state and national awards with badges and certificates.

Finally, the Vote of thanks was proposed followed by the National Anthem.
